Ischemic preconditioning, insulin, and morphine all cause hexokinase redistribution

Summary

Cardioprotective interventions like insulin and morphine promote hexokinase (HK) movement to mitochondria. This translocation preserves heart cell integrity and reduces cell death, offering a novel therapeutic insight.
